Kiyoshi Nose is a scholar working on Molecular Biology, Oncology and Cancer Research. According to data from OpenAlex, Kiyoshi Nose has authored 120 papers receiving a total of 4.4k indexed citations (citations by other indexed papers that have themselves been cited), including 87 papers in Molecular Biology, 19 papers in Oncology and 19 papers in Cancer Research. Recurrent topics in Kiyoshi Nose’s work include Cell Adhesion Molecules Research (18 papers), Cellular Mechanics and Interactions (10 papers) and Cancer, Hypoxia, and Metabolism (9 papers). Kiyoshi Nose is often cited by papers focused on Cell Adhesion Molecules Research (18 papers), Cellular Mechanics and Interactions (10 papers) and Cancer, Hypoxia, and Metabolism (9 papers). Kiyoshi Nose collaborates with scholars based in Japan, United States and Germany. Kiyoshi Nose's co-authors include Motoko Shibanuma, Toshio Kuroki, Jun‐ichi Mashimo, Masaaki Ohba, Kazunori Mori, Joo‐ri Kim‐Kaneyama, Naoyuki Nishiya, Akira Mita, Hiroshi Okamoto and Hajime Kageyama and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Circulation.
